Transaction d874f426b26aaeb31b92ca12035c162461384370e2739d1a8192e482353033f1
1 Input
2 Outputs
- d874f426b26aaeb31b92ca12035c162461384370e2739d1a8192e482353033f1:0
- d874f426b26aaeb31b92ca12035c162461384370e2739d1a8192e482353033f1:1
value 2390344
address 1DEX98rsVN7e98nSwcdfw4LemdaHs8JWr6
value 85216051
address 1KmJeVKZszS63wMeXmjxUedMgnu8XD6mrK